I tested this out with my companion vs. a guild mate. We both broke out Ensign Temple. I equipped her first with PvE gear (all 168). Then I had her beat on the other Temple until dead. And then beat on the guildmate until defeated. Switched over to her PvP set (all 162) and repeated. Also did reverse: had my guildie and his Temple do the same to my Temple in the different sets.

 

Outcome: After timing all the matches, my Temple lasted longer and took a better beating with the PvP gear and defeated them quicker despite the lower rating. So based on this direct experience, Expertise seems to work in open world PvP.
